LONG-FLOWERED MERTENSIA

Class: Mertensia longiflora
Family: BORAGE FAMILY
Sub Family: Boraginaceae
Year: Biennial
Other Names: Languid Ladies, Mountain Bluebell
Colour: Bright blue
Height: 10-25 cm (4-10")
Each Flower: 2-2.5 cm (3/4-1") long, tubular, expanding into 5 shallow lobes, expanded portion being 1/3-1/2 as long as tube; calyx cleft to below midway into 5 pointed teeth; 5 stamens attached to base of expanded portion of tube; long, thin style protrudes just beyond tube
Leaves: Stalkless leaves arranged alternately up stem, fleshy, inverted lance-shaped to oblong, with rounded tips, often with pinkish mid-ribs beneath
Stems: Sturdy, round, smooth, often pinkish-tinged
Blooming Period: April - June
Habitat: Open or slightly wooded sagebrush country with Ponderosa pine up to middle elevations
